Key Skills for Private Practice Managers

Private practice management requires a unique set of proficiencies. A successful manager must be able to successfully oversee all aspects of the private practice manager practice, from fiscal operations to client relations. Key among these skills are strong communication abilities, exceptional analytical skills, and a deep understanding of the healthcare industry.

Furthermore, practice managers must be proficient in marketing, systems implementation, and legal matters. They must also possess the management skills necessary to inspire a team of employees.

Developing these essential skills is crucial for any aspiring private practice manager who aims to build and sustain a thriving practice.
